Dutchmans pipe flower drop

The blossoms on my dutchmans pipe vine seem to be falling off. I don’t think the local critters are eating them off. I see the baby pipes and 3-4 days later they have dropped. Any suggestions? Fertilizers?

Sorry, but I can’t answer your question outright. From what I’ve read, these must be kept moist. If they are stressed, the plants will throw blooms as a survival tactic.
